Posthumous Cameo and Honors Confirmed After Fernando Esteso’s Death at 80

His agent confirms a final role in Torrente 6, with Aragón preparing a posthumous cultural medal.

Overview

  • Esteso died on February 1 at Valencia’s Hospital La Fe from respiratory complications after being admitted a few days earlier.
  • His agent confirmed a posthumous cameo in Torrente 6, which is scheduled to premiere on March 13.
  • Andrés Pajares mourned publicly and said he would not attend the funeral, with his daughter later saying he is devastated.
  • Santiago Segura and Spain’s film academy led tributes that emphasized Esteso’s influence on Transition‑era popular comedy.
  • Aragón’s president announced a posthumous Medalla al Mérito Cultural, as separate reports described a modest estate following past financial troubles.
